Common Commercial Slab Installation Jobs
Commercial slab installation involves preparing and pouring concrete slabs for various business and industrial projects.
Foundation slabs provide a stable base for retail stores, warehouses, and office buildings.
Parking lot slabs create durable surfaces for vehicle parking areas and access roads.
Loading dock slabs support heavy equipment and facilitate efficient freight handling.
Sidewalk and walkway slabs enhance safety and accessibility around commercial properties.
Industrial flooring slabs are designed to withstand heavy loads and high traffic environments.
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are typically used for building foundations, parking areas,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ties.
What factors influence the thickness of a commercial slab? The intended use, load requirements, and soil conditions help determine the appropriate thickness for a commercial slab.
How is a commercial slab prepared before installation? Proper site grading, soil compaction, and form setting are essential steps to ensure a stable and level slab surface.
What materials are commonly used for commercial slabs? Reinforced concrete is the standard material, often combined with steel reinforcement to improve durability and strength.
